Default 850 Wagon/Sedan Brake Compatability

Are the rear rotors/calipers compatable between the 850 Wagon and sedan? as well as year compatability?

Easy way is to check FCP or some other site, cross reference PNs. 93 is 4 lug. 95-97 is 5 lug, otherwise they should be the same.

Yes they are transferable, infact you could throw them on a s70 aswell....rear brakes are only different when going to awd like my 850 wagon. It seems to have the same brakes as a v70r awd
